According to one of my numerous doctors, the chances of a complete remission drops precipitously after two years. In younger people it can go away and disappear for all practical purposes. Older persons who experience remission are always on the verge of it returning. Even those who have remission it often will not be complete.

Most sufferers, I believe, are searching more for a plateau where the symptoms are as manageable as possible.

Age of onset and lenght of time till treatment are critical to good outcomes.
